:iconsumopiggy:
Hey, I normally only use a default round soft brush, with pen pressure for Opacity and Flow, that's all. In this one I played around with a custom brush that I painted with the default brush lol.

It just takes time and practise, and a tablet is pretty much essential, tho some achieve some nice effects with a mouse :D
